Abstract
The present invention relates to a method for quantifying the amount of active transforming growth factor beta (TGF-β) in biological samples. In particular the method comprising incubating cryosections of a tissue with cells which contain a TGF-β responsive expression vector having a structural region encoding an indicator protein and measuring the amount of said indicator protein expressed from the cells.
